			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>For the past two years, there have been rumors as to whether the role of the Joker would be re-cast so the character could return in <em>Batman 3</em> after Heath Ledger&#8217;s untimely death and Oscar winning performance in <em>The Dark Knight</em>. Many believed that Johnny Depp would be a good choice as a potential re-cast while others argued that it would be in bad taste to have the Joker return so soon after Ledgers epic portrayal of Batman&#8217;s nemesis. Those rumors can now be put to rest as Christopher Nolan has broken his silence on the subject <a href="http://www.empireonline.com/">when asked</a> if we&#8217;ll see the Joker again:</p>
<blockquote><p>“No”, says Nolan emphatically and unhesitatingly. He resists elaborating simply because, quite understandably, he says, “I just don’t feel comfortable talking about it”.</p></blockquote>
<p>So there you have, no Joker in <em>Batman 3</em>. Now the real question is what villain(s) will we see in the upcoming sequel to <em>The Dark Knight</em>?</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Warner Bros. has officially announced that the sequel to <em>The Dark Knight</em> and third Batman film by Christopher Nolan will be released on <strong>July 20, 2012</strong>. While there are still no details about the plot or what the name might possibly be, THR is reporting:</p>
<p style="padding-left: 30px;">&#8220;The studio has barely begun the process of developing the movie; Christopher Nolan is in postproduction on “Inception,” but is hammering out a story with David Goyer.&#8221;</p>
<p>With both Nolan and Goyer already signed on, the third installment in the series may have a chance at being even more successful than <em>The Dark Knight</em>. However, it&#8217;s a ballsy move by Warner Bros. to set Batman 3 for release in the summer of 2012 with <em>The Avengers</em> on May 4th, <em>Star Trek 2</em> on June 29th and the <em>Spider-Man</em> reboot on July 3rd. With so many big budget action movies set for release it the summer of 2012, it will be exciting to see which movies stick to their release dates and who will emerge as the highest grossing film.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>One of the biggest surprises of this years Spike Video Game Awards (besides that they actually picked the right Game of the Year) was the announcement that after just releasing <em>Batman: Arkham Asylum</em> back in August, Rocksteady Studios has already starting working on a sequel. It was officially announced during the beginning of the show with a trailer showing a sickly Joker recovering from the events of the first game in a rundown carnival. <h3>During the Credits</h3>
<p>There are black and white illustrations of the characters shown.</p>
<h3>After the Credits (spoilers)</h3>
<p>There are multiple random extra scenes that are shown after the credits. The extra scene starts off with Batman flying away in the Batwing as the camera then tilts down to show a hand reaching out of the water. While the scene begins the same, the hand is random and is either the hand of Bane, Killer Croc or Scarecrow.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Considering its Michael Phelps-style smashing of numerous records, chances are you’ve already seen <em>The Dark Knight</em>… more than once. And why not? The <em>Batman Begins</em> sequel, which follows the conflicted vigilante’s descent in Gotham’s public eye and his arch nemesis’ parallel rise atop the city’s underworld, demands multiple viewings for plenty of reasons. The most popular one, I’m sure you’ve heard by now, is the brilliant and unforgettable performance by Heath Ledger, who crawls under your skin and is sure to be Oscar-nominated at least. <span id="more-2984"></span>While his instantly legendary portrayal of The Joker garners endless and well-deserved buzz, don’t count out Aaron Eckhart’s masterful supporting turn either. The beautiful movie is gripping right off the bat, but its greatest feat may be that even after an enthralling ride that clocks in at 2 ½ hours, it still leaves you wanting more, immediately as the credits roll. As the box office behemoth begins to lift its threat of sinking <em>Titanic</em>’s domestic gross mark, now’s the perfect time to re-catch the only major feature film partially shot using IMAX cameras. Aside from the occasional cheeseball one-liner and Christian Bale’s… <em>interesting</em> Batman voice, <em>The Dark Knight</em> reigns over this summer with near perfection.</p>
